Digital News Report 2026
As the world changes at accelerating speed, news media report and update on these events around the clock, jostling for a share of the four to five hours each day that people devote to their smartphones. For some, this means new opportunities to stay close to news stories as they unfold; for others, it risks creating a sense of overload.

The Metric Media network runs more than 1,200 local news sites. Here are some of the non-profits funding them.
<p>This is the first part of a two-part investigation. The second piece can be found here. As local news outlets across the US struggle to stay afloat, pop-up newsrooms are filling the void. Organizations with ties to political parties, special-interest groups, and lobbyists have emerged under the guise of news. One of the biggest such […]</p>
